Location

Situated just outside Stellenbosch in the beautiful Cape winelands, Cultivar Guest Lodge is an ideal accommodation for guests searching tranquillity and a warm and friendly service. In the centre of the spacious garden, the swimming pool is overlooking Stellenbosch’s mountains. Surrounded by numerous exotic birds and flowers, it is the ideal place to enjoy the view and the South African sun. The city centre of Stellenbosch is a driving distance of 10 minutes. Several well-known wine estates and restaurants are located in the surrounding area. Cape Town International Airport can be reached by car in approx. 30 minutes and Cape Town city centre in 45 min.

  • User:34769pete

    Trip type: Couples

    Nice hotel but lacking in basic amenities.

    rating23 May 2026

    We enjoyed our 3 night stay here. The hotel is situated a 10 minute drive outside of Stellenbosch.There isn't a restaurant other than for breakfast and there are no other dining facilities anywhere close by, so you really require a car here.The security is good, behind a large sliding gate.Both of the 2 swimming pools are nice with good sun loungers and amazing views. The room was okay. The bedroom was a bit in the small size, although the bathroom was a good size and the shower enormous. Bathroom fittings were modern and there were twin sinks.The thing we didn't like was there wasn't a TV and in a country like SA where you are in bed quite early, we really missed this. The internet was also pretty intermittent in our room, so we couldn't download anything on to a tablet etc.The other anomaly was there wasn't a proper wardrobe, just a peg type place to hang 3 or 4 coat hangers.There was an in room safe.The breakfasts were acceptable although quite limited in choice.We wouldn't return though due to lack of TV as surely in this day and age that's a prerequisite for a hotel.

  • User:BeerMin

    Trip type: Couples

    A Stay That Misses the Four-Star Mark

    rating11 Sept 2025

    The property offers spacious rooms with air conditioning, private bathrooms, and spa-quality toiletries, along with complimentary Wi-Fi and parking. Breakfast is adequate, and the landscaped grounds provide a pleasant, quiet setting.However, the experience falls short of four-star expectations. Complimentary bottled water was only supplied on the first day, and additional bottles had to be purchased. Standard amenities such as on-site dining beyond breakfast, a fitness center, concierge services, room service, 24-hour reception, a flat-screen TV, and work desk were notably absent. While a Nespresso machine was provided, coffee pods came at an extra cost.Rather than delivering a sense of comfort and luxury, the hotel felt deserted after dark, with no facilities, no atmosphere, and not even a television available. What could have been a refined four-star stay was instead a quiet but underwhelming experience.
